Jill Mansell, unlike other writers in the rom-com arena, seems to get better with every book she writes. Thinking of You is her latest offering and proves that it is possible to get better with age!
Ginny Holland, a best selling author if left rattling around in her house on her own after daughter Jem goes to university. Lonely, she advertises her spare room for rent. Instead of a happy roommate, she gets moaning Laurel who is still hung up on her ex-boyfriend. If that wasn’t enough, Ginny finds herself lusting after two men who can only be bad for her. Will Ginny get the man of her dreams, or will he be the one that gets away?
Mansell has a disarming ability to create characters that you already know and that tends to make her books impossible to put down. This book is no different. It is charmingly written, hopelessly funny and will make you forget all of your own troubles as soon as you read the first page.

2007-09-03 Mind-boggling
Put briefly this is an amazing book! Whether its the vast amount of research carried out, the fantastic photography or the accessibility of writing, Extreme Nature is masterly in almost every way.It is written in the from of about 150 'record breakers' each taking up a double page spread. On one side is an invariably brilliant photograph featuring the organism in question and taking up the whole page, while on the other are a few short paragraphs explaining the record the animal sets and how & why it does it. The records range from the usual (largest egg) to the more obscure (most imaginative use of dung) and the humorous (sexiest beast)!
One of the best things about this book is the simplicity of writing. Carwardine resists the temptation to write reams about each animal, and condenses the facts down to a couple of well written paragraphs which are easily understood. There are many statistics but he only mentions those that are necessary and they do not stifle the fluidity of the reading.
The wealth of experience and knowledge that Carwardine has brought together in the creation of Extreme Nature is extraordinary. The acknowledgements section covers two pages and contains well over 100 names - world leaders in their various fields of science and photography which accounts for the undeniable quality of the photos as well as the information.
I read Extreme Nature cover to cover but it can also be used as a 'dip in' book to be used now and then. The book shows off evolution and the natural world in all her glory and hopefully will play a part in persuading more people to hep conserve these fantastic animals and plants.
